3. May the terms to a written contract be changed by oral evidence?

Law
1 answer:
myrzilka [38]3 years ago
7 0

Answer: It is stated that the terms of a written contract may not be changed by evidence of any prior agreement but may be explained, or supplemented, in the: Uniform Commercial Code (UCC). Oral evidence introduced after a contract is signed is legally accepted if it clarifies some point in the: ... executory contracts.

What other science tool do we need to use with a wind vane?
wel

Answer:

A RAIN GAUGE measures the amount of rain that has fallen over a specific time period. A WIND VANE is an instrument that determines the direction from which the wind is blowing. An ANEMOMETER measures wind speed.
